Description
This book explores : two reasons why marriages fail ; how to meet the needs of your spouse ; how a husband's lack of affection weakens a marriage ; crucial differences between men and women ; how to motivate your spouse to listen to you. The first half of the book discusses the husband's part in building a successful relationship. The second half of the book shows how wives can nurture their marriages. --from back cover.Tags

Gary Smalley, president of Today's Family in Branson, Missouri, holds a bachelor's degree in psychology and has a master's degree from Bethel Seminary. John Trent, president of Encouraging Words Ministry, holds a master's degree in New Testament Greek from Dallas Theological Seminary and a Ph.D. in marriage and family counseling from Texas State show more University. show less
